Don’t Forget to Breathe: Mindful Breathing for Stress Relief

Mindful Breathing for Stress Relief

Have you ever found yourself in the middle of a hectic day, running from one task to another, only to realize you’ve been holding your breath? In these fast-paced moments, mindful breathing for stress relief can be a game-changer. Taking just a few seconds to focus on your breath can calm your mind, ease tension, and help you regain balance.

It’s a common occurrence in our fast-paced lives. We get so wrapped up in our to-do lists, deadlines, and endless notifications that we forget to do one of the most basic and essential things: breathe.

Breathing is the foundation of life. It’s something we do without thinking, yet it has a profound impact on our well-being. When we breathe deeply and mindfully, we nourish our bodies and calm our minds. 

Next time you’re feeling overwhelmed, try this: inhale deeply through your nose, hold for a few seconds, and then exhale slowly through your mouth. Repeat a few times. Feel that? It’s like a mini-vacation for your brain.

Incorporating mindful breathing into your daily routine doesn’t have to be a chore. In fact, it can be quite fun! Set reminders on your phone, place sticky notes around your workspace, or pair breathing exercises with daily activities like brushing your teeth or waiting for your coffee to brew.

Beyond reducing stress, deep breathing has numerous health benefits. It can improve digestion, boost the immune system, enhance sleep quality, and increase energy levels. Plus, it’s free and can be done anywhere, anytime.

So, the next time you’re caught in the whirlwind of life, remember to stop and take a deep breath. It’s the simplest, yet most effective way to recharge and find your balance. And who knows? With a little more oxygen in your system, you might just feel a bit more inspired, a tad more relaxed, and a whole lot happier.
